Coconut Ice Cream Ingredients
• • All you need to make this delight!
For the Base
- Full Fat Coconut Milk – Provides creaminess and richness; use only full fat for the best texture.
- Condensed Coconut Milk – Adds sweetness and helps keep the ice cream soft; may be substituted with store-bought or homemade options.
- Coconut Cream – Enhances the creamy texture; can use the solid part of refrigerated coconut milk if needed.
- Salt – Enhances flavor; a pinch is sufficient.
Optional Flavor Add-Ins
- Grated Nutmeg – Adds warmth and spice; can omit for a more straightforward coconut flavor.
- Vanilla Extract – Provides depth to flavor; feel free to skip if not available.
- Dark Rum – Adds complexity in flavor; this is not necessary for a delicious outcome.

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Easy Vegan Coconut Ice Cream
Step 1: Prepare Your Ice Cream Maker
Ensure that the bowl of your ice cream maker is completely frozen, which typically takes at least 11 hours. This is crucial for achieving a smooth texture in your Coconut Ice Cream, so plan ahead! Once ready, gather all your ingredients to streamline the process and allow for a fun, uninterrupted cooking experience.
Step 2: Blend the Base Ingredients
In a blender, combine the full-fat coconut milk, condensed coconut milk, and coconut cream. Blend on high until the mixture is completely smooth and creamy, taking about 1-2 minutes. Look for a rich consistency without any lumps, as this will create a luxurious texture for your Coconut Ice Cream.
Step 3: Chill the Mixture
Transfer the blended mixture into a container and chill it in the refrigerator for a minimum of 4 hours, or overnight for the best results. This helps the flavors meld beautifully, ensuring a more decadent taste when you churn it. Make sure it’s covered to prevent any unwanted odors from invading your creamy delight.
Step 4: Whisk and Churn
After the chilling period, remove the mixture from the fridge and give it a thorough whisk to incorporate any separated components. Then, pour the chilled mixture into your ice cream maker and churn it according to the manufacturer’s instructions until it reaches a firm, soft-serve consistency, usually about 20-30 minutes.
Step 5: Freeze the Ice Cream
Once churning is complete, transfer your Coconut Ice Cream into a freezer-proof container. Smooth the top with a spatula and place it in the freezer for at least 4 hours to firm up. This step is essential for achieving that creamy scoopable texture when you’re ready to serve and enjoy your delightful homemade treat.

How to Store and Freeze Coconut Ice Cream
Fridge: Store any leftover Coconut Ice Cream in an airtight container for up to 3 days to maintain its creamy texture.
Freezer: For best results, keep the Coconut Ice Cream in a freezer-proof container. It can be frozen for up to 2 months, but remember it’ll be firm right from the freezer.
Soften Before Serving: Let the ice cream sit at room temperature for about 15 minutes before scooping. This helps achieve that ideal soft-serve-like consistency.
Airtight is Key: Make sure the container is airtight to prevent freezer burn and to keep the delightful coconut flavor intact over time.
Expert Tips for Coconut Ice Cream
• Smooth Mixture: Ensure the coconut mixture is totally lump-free before chilling. This step is vital for a velvety Coconut Ice Cream.
• Chill, Chill, Chill: Always chill the mixture thoroughly before churning; it allows flavors to deepen and helps achieve a creamy texture.
• Manual Method: If you don’t have an ice cream maker, place the mixture in a container and whisk every 30 minutes while it freezes to maintain creaminess.
• Perfect Serve: Allow the Coconut Ice Cream to soften at room temperature for about 15 minutes before scooping for the best scoopable texture.

Easy Vegan Coconut Ice Cream Recipe FAQs
How can I select the best coconut milk for this recipe?
Absolutely! For the creamiest texture, always go for full-fat coconut milk. Check the can for any additives; ideally, it should contain just coconut milk and water. Look for brands that specify organic or BPA-free packaging for an extra health kick!
How should I store leftover Coconut Ice Cream?
Very good question! Store any leftover Coconut Ice Cream in an airtight container in the freezer for up to 2 months. Make sure to seal it tightly to prevent freezer burn. If you don’t mind a firmer texture, you can keep it frozen longer, but it’s best enjoyed within this timeframe.
Can I freeze Coconut Ice Cream without an ice cream maker?
Yes, indeed! If you don’t have an ice cream maker, pour the blended mixture into a container and place it in the freezer. After about 30 minutes, take it out and whisk vigorously to break up any ice crystals. Repeat this process every 30 minutes, for about 3 hours, until it’s the perfect creamy texture you desire.
What should I do if my ice cream turns out icy or grainy?
Oh, no! If your ice cream ends up icy, it may be due to not blending the mixture thoroughly. To prevent this, make sure the mixture is completely smooth before chilling. Additionally, ensure proper chilling before churning and whisk every 30 minutes if using the manual method. If icy blobs do happen, try blending the ice cream again until smooth before serving.
